Meloni plans to run for the European Parliament

Image: Getty Images

Meloni’s name will be on the ballot for the ruling Brothers of Italy party in all five Italian constituencies in European Parliament elections scheduled for June 6-9.

Italian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ni said she will run in the European Parliament elections, Reuters wrote.

“We want to do in Europe what we did in Italy… create a majority that unites the center-right and sends the left into opposition,” Meloni told a party conference in the city of Pescara.

Meloni will reportedly top the ballot for the ruling Brothers of Italy party in all five Italian constituencies in European Parliament elections scheduled for June 6-9.

Meloni assured that he would not use “not even one minute” of his time as prime minister to campaign.

We remind you that Giorgia Meloni is the first female prime minister in Italian history. He will lead the country’s government in the fall of 2022.
